Testen Sie die Vorschaufunktionen in SharePoint-Frameworks

Ab Version 1.5.0 können Sie die Vorschaufunktionen in SharePoint-Frameworks testen. In diesem Artikel wird beschrieben, wie Sie in SharePoint-Framework mithilfe der Vorschaufunktionen Projekte erstellen. Zudem nennt er Faktoren, die Sie beim Arbeiten mit den Vorschaufunktionen berücksichtigen sollten.

Wichtig

Das Erstellen von Projekten in SharePoint-Frameworks mithilfe von Vorschaufunktionen ist nur zu Testzwecken gedacht. Das Erstellen von Projekten mithilfe von Vorschaufunktionen in Produktionsumgebungen wird nicht unterstützt. Microsoft gewährleistet nicht, dass eine der Vorschaufunktionen für Produktionsmandanten freigegeben wird. Microsoft kann Vorschaufunktionen ohne vorherige Ankündigung ändern oder entfernen.

Was sind Vorschaufunktionen in SharePoint-Frameworks?

Zur Weiterentwicklung von SharePoint-Framework möchte Microsoft Feedback zu den verschiedenen Vorschaufunktionen erhalten, die zum Hinzufügen in SharePoint-Framework in Betracht gezogen werden. Zudem fragen Organisationen nach einer Vorschau auf künftige Funktionen, sowohl um Feedback zu geben als auch um diese für zukünftige Projekte zu berücksichtigen.

Ab Version 1.5.0 bietet Microsoft Organisationen die Möglichkeit, Vorschaufunktionen in SharePoint-Frameworks zu bewerten. Diese Funktionen sind über einen separaten Satz von npm-Paketen verfügbar, die mit der Bezeichnung Plusbeta gekennzeichnet sind und von zusätzlichen API-Optionen bis zu vollständigen Funktionen reichen. Obwohl SemVer-Bezeichnungen in der Regel verwendet werden, um ein Vorabversion zu kennzeichnen, gibt die Bezeichnung Plusbeta in diesem Fall an, dass das npm-Packet zusätzliche Vorschaufunktionen enthält. Die Version 1.5.0-plusbeta des SharePoint-Frameworks umfasst z. B. alle Funktionen der Version 1.5.0 sowie einige zusätzliche experimentelle Funktionen.

Wenn Sie SharePoint-Frameworks-Projekte mithilfe des normalen SharePoint-Framework Yeoman-Generators (@microsoft/generator-sharepoint) skizzieren, können Sie auswählen, ob Sie die Vorschaufunktionen verwenden möchten oder nicht. Basierend auf Ihrer Wahl, erstellt der Generator entweder ein Projekt, das Sie in einer Produktionsumgebung ausführen können, oder ein Projekt, das Sie zum Auswerten der experimentelle Funktionen verwenden können. Beachten Sie jedoch, dass es keine Garantie für die Übernahme von Funktionen einer Plusbeta-Version in zukünftige SharePoint-Framework-Versionen gibt und dass die Verwendung von in Plusbeta-Versionen erstellten Lösungen in Produktionsumgebungen nicht unterstützt wird.

Hinweis

Feedback zu den bereitgestellten Vorschaufunktionen ist erwünscht. Verwenden Sie hierzu die Problemliste im GitHub-Repository unter sp-dev-docs.

SharePoint-Framework-Projekte mithilfe von Vorschaufunktionen erstellen

Ab Version 1.5.0, können Sie zum Erstellen von Projekten, die die Vorschaufunktionen von SharePoint-Framework verwenden, den SharePoint-Framework Yeoman-Generator verwenden. Fügen Sie zum Einschließen von Vorschaufunktionen den plusbeta-Switch zum yo-Befehl hinzu, z. B.:

yo @microsoft/sharepoint --plusbeta

Nach dem Ausführen dieses Befehls, wird der SharePoint-Framework Yeoman-Generator ein neues SharePoint-Projekt skizzieren und dabei alle zu diesem Zeitpunkt zur Verfügung stehenden Vorschaufunktionen verwenden. Weitere Informationen über die verfügbaren Vorschaufunktionen finden Sie in den Versionshinweisen des SharePoint-Framework Yeoman-Generators.

Wenn der Plusbeta-Switch verwendet wurde, verweist package.json auf verschiedene Pakete für das skizzierte Projekt mit der Markierung @plusbeta.